Transaction 86bb91d836ffca66b2c87418b9f70023421e2c9715a8d6d348da0ab17ef550f3
1 Input
1 Output
-
86bb91d836ffca66b2c87418b9f70023421e2c9715a8d6d348da0ab17ef550f3:0
- value
- 349693544
- script pubkey
- OP_0 OP_PUSHBYTES_20 744abeb3ca4842f11349a8e3edc8c0862ac657d4
- address
- bc1qw39tav72fpp0zy6f4r37mjxqsc4vv475nw3dyg